Function
Skin-conditioning agent–miscellaneous; primary sphingoid base backbone for sphingosine-based ceramides (Ceramide NS, AS, EOS). (E)-2-amino-4-octadecen-1,3-diol; trans-D-erythro-sphingosine. Participates in ceramide biosynthesis via ceramide synthase (N-acylation of sphingosine with fatty acids). The trans-double bond at C4 is characteristic of human sphingosine and differentiates it from phytosphingosine (no double bond, additional C4-hydroxyl). Bioactive lipid mediator: sphingosine and its phosphorylated form (sphingosine-1-phosphate, S1P) are key regulators of keratinocyte proliferation, differentiation, and apoptosis.

Regulatory Status

EU EU Status permitted
US US Status permitted
US Notes Endogenous human bioactive lipid. CIR 2020 umbrella assessment of ceramide/sphingolipid class covers sphingosine safety in cosmetic use. No FDA OTC drug concerns for skin-conditioning applications. MoCRA compliance required. Commercial sources: synthetic or semi-synthetic.
